🏠 Buyer Tips

Get pre-approved financing before viewing properties to strengthen offers in competitive markets. Hire a professional home inspector experienced with older homes and potential code issues. Budget 15-25% beyond purchase price for renovations and unexpected repairs. Consider contractor estimates before making offers. Research local building permits and zoning regulations. Evaluate neighborhood trends and comparable sales data. Factor in holding costs and timeline for completion.

🔑 Seller Tips

Price competitively based on after-repair value to attract investor buyers. Disclose all known issues transparently to avoid legal complications. Consider selling to investors as-is to expedite closing. Stage homes showing structural bones and potential. Provide inspection reports and contractor estimates to build buyer confidence. Highlight location benefits and strong rental market potential. Time listings for maximum exposure.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of fixer uppers are available in Pico Rivera? +
Pico Rivera offers diverse fixer upper opportunities including single-family homes, multi-unit properties, and investment buildings. Most range from 1950s-1970s construction with potential for modernization, structural updates, or cosmetic improvements. Properties vary from cosmetic fixes to major renovations, providing options for different investment levels and buyer expertise.
Is financing available for fixer upper homes in Pico Rivera? +
Yes, several financing options exist for fixer uppers including FHA loans with renovation escrow, conventional rehabilitation loans, and investment property mortgages. Some lenders offer specialized fixer upper financing with construction funds held in escrow. Work with lenders experienced in renovation properties to maximize available options and competitive rates.
What's the typical renovation cost in Pico Rivera? +
Renovation costs vary significantly based on project scope. Cosmetic updates average $20,000-$50,000. Mid-level renovations including kitchen/bath updates range $75,000-$150,000. Major structural work and complete remodels can exceed $200,000. Local contractor rates and material costs affect final expenses. Budget contingency funds for unexpected issues discovered during renovation.
How long does it take to renovate a fixer upper in Pico Rivera? +
Timeline depends on project scope and contractor availability. Cosmetic renovations typically take 2-3 months. Mid-level projects require 4-6 months. Major renovations involving permits and structural work may take 8-12 months or longer. Pico Rivera's permit processes generally move efficiently, though factor in unexpected delays and contractor scheduling.
What ROI can I expect from Pico Rivera fixer uppers? +
ROI varies based on purchase price, renovation costs, and market conditions. Many investors achieve 15-25% returns on successful projects. Rental properties offer ongoing income potential with appreciation. Conservative estimates suggest 18-month breakeven timelines for value-add properties.
